Bessemer Group's Q4 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2025, Bessemer Group held 2,783 positions worth $65.1B, down 0.39% from $65.4B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 36% of the portfolio.

Bessemer Group's Q4 2025 filing shows 228 new, 1,171 increased, 762 reduced and 188 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Qnity Electronics Inc: 53,605 shares worth $4.38M. The largest sale was Microsoft, an estimated $557M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 28% of assets, down from 29%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Communication Services.
